Navigating Senior Home Care in Greenville: A Family's Guide to 2026

It started with a fall.

Your mom spent three hours on the kitchen floor before anyone found her. She's physically fine—but everything feels different now.

Suddenly, the question you've been avoiding is staring you in the face: *How do we keep her safe at home without taking away her independence?*

Thousands of Greenville families are navigating the same fears, the same questions, and the same confusing maze of options.

Here's what most people don't realize about senior home care in 2026:

→ Non-medical home care costs about $35/hour in Greenville
→ The caregiver shortage means finding (and keeping) quality help is harder than ever
→ Most families haven't actually asked their parent what they want

The hardest part? Having the conversation you're avoiding.

The uncomfortable truth about senior care planning:

59% of families wait until after a fall or hospitalization to ask for help.

A new survey from the Aging Life Care Association confirms what we see here in the Upstate every day: families plan in crisis mode instead of planning ahead. And over half don't have advance care directives in place.

The result? Fewer options, higher costs, and decisions made under pressure.

Why Many Seniors Don't Ask Their Adult Children for Help 💙

It's not always because they don't need it—often, it's about wanting to stay independent and in control.

Families are usually the first to notice subtle changes: missed appointments, confusion, falls, or withdrawal. But starting that conversation? It can feel really uncomfortable.

Here's how to approach it with care:

✓ Lead with love, not judgment
✓ Share what you've observed, not accusations
✓ Offer support as a partnership, not a takeover

The Top 5 Reasons Seniors Hesitate to Ask for Help:

1️⃣ Desire for Independence
2️⃣ Fear of Being a Burden
3️⃣ Denial or Lack of Awareness
4️⃣ Role Reversal Discomfort
5️⃣ Fear of Losing Autonomy or Control
